wlan.wep.index
Description This printer setting refers to the WEP (Wired Equivalent Privacy) encryption
key index. This printer setting determines which one of the four encryption keys is to be used
by the client (printer). For printer support, see SGD Command Support on page 315.
Type getvar; setvar
This table identifies the commands for this format:
Note • For details on SGD command structure, see Command Structure onpage 250.
Commands Details
getvar This command instructs the printer to respond with the encryption key
index.
Format: ! U1 getvar "wlan.wep.index"
setvar This command instructs the printer to set the encryption key index.
Format: ! U1 setvar "wlan.wep.index" "value"
Valu e s :
"1" = enables encryption key 1
"2" = enables encryption key 2
"3" = enables encryption key 3
"4" = enables encryption key 4
Default: "1"
Example • This setvar example shows the value set to "1".

! U1 setvar "wlan.wep.index" "1"

When the setvar value is set to "1", the getvar result is "1".
